Horace Weston was often called the greatest banjo player in the world when he was alive. He published a couple dozen banjo solos, mostly through S.S. Stewart's publications, in the late 1800s. He was one of the first African-American composers to get recognition and respect for his invaluable contributions to banjo music and American culture. Here it is presented in tablature for the first time. This works for 5-string banjos tuned in C. This is like standard/open G tuning except you lower your fourth string from D to a C. There are Roman numerals where using a barre with your left index finger can help execute some of the trickier passages. ISBN 9781619110403. 8.75x11.75 inches.Here is a book of tunes from the Elizabethan era-the great period of English song-set in tablature for the clawhammer banjo. At first glance, it is true, the songs of Shakespeare-s day and the mountain banjo seem to be worlds apart. But the musical traditions are, in fact, related, as Elizabethan songs are the old world cousins of mountain tunes. As a result, Elizabethan tunes are a natural way to extend the mountain banjo repertoire for intermediate and advanced players. Their pedigree, their modal feel, the lilting rhythms, and the ease with which they can be adapted to the banjo argue the case. At the same time, they open the possibility for new sounds-in particular new rhythms-for the old instrument, pushing the banjo beyond unnatural limitations and giving it a new voice. Each section of the book is organized around a traditional mountain tuning, with a mountain song serving as a model of that tuning, illuminating the relationship between the two musical worlds. The Bard's Banjo is the first banjo instruction book devoted to the repertoire of Elizabethan song. Includes access to online audio.

This is an arrangement of the Christmas Classic Rudolph the Red-nosed Reindeer for clawhammer banjo.Although I listed as intermediate, it is really more beginner/intermediate.  It uses mostly bum ditty, hammer ons/pull offs with open strings, and some simple drop thumb patterns.  The whole song stays in the first five frets.  But I marked it as intermediate because it uses a variant of Cumberland Gap tuning, and the tempo is rather fast.  It is a great tune for learning just how much one can produce with basic clawhammer techniques in Cumberland Gap tuning.

This is a clawhammer arrangement of the traditional hymn What A Friend We Have In Jesus.  It is arranged to help beginning and intermediate players practice alternate string hammer-on and pull-off techniques, as well as drop thumb if desired.  I actually wrote this arrangement in my early days playing clawhammer, before I was able to drop thumb, in order to practice alternate string techniques.This tune can easily be repeated as needed, and makes great background music for church services.
